Market Snapshot: Bicycle Wheels Market Size and Growth

The bicycle wheels market grew from USD 1.07 billion in 2024 to USD 1.12 billion in 2025, and is poised for continued expansion at a CAGR of 5.10%, reaching USD 1.59 billion by 2032. The primary factors propelling market development include shifting consumer preferences toward active lifestyles, a heightened commitment to environmental responsibility, and increasing traction for high-performance, lightweight wheel products. Industry momentum is further fueled by urban mobility initiatives and a strong focus on delivery of both commuter and recreational cycling solutions.

Key Takeaways: Strategic Insights and Market Dynamics

  • Rising demand for premium, technologically advanced wheels is reshaping both aftermarket and OEM supplier strategies, with increased emphasis on advanced material science and aerodynamics.
  • Production advances, including automated carbon fiber layup, CNC machining, and additive manufacturing, are accelerating product development while optimizing manufacturing efficiency.
  • Collaboration between material scientists and industry leaders is facilitating the adoption of novel composites and alloys, allowing for continued product differentiation and sustainability initiatives.
  • Sustainability imperatives are driving investments in bio-based resins and closed-loop aluminum recycling, prompting circular economy practices and growing regulatory alignment, particularly in European markets.
  • Regional market differences influence wheel feature preferences, from agility and maneuverability in the Americas to reinforced durability in Asia-Pacific and stringent eco-standards in EMEA.

Tariff Impact: Navigating Regulatory Disruption

New United States tariffs, effective in 2025, have triggered significant supply chain recalibration across the bicycle wheels market. Key industry stakeholders are strengthening procurement strategies and exploring alternate sourcing to address rising input costs. These measures also fuel regional diversification, vertical integration, and a move toward dynamic pricing solutions that reflect shifting trade policy environments. Forward-looking companies are expanding local operations and forming joint ventures to insulate supply chains from disruptive tariff effects.
